Writing Process vs. AI and Voice-to-Text Options

Susan Paton explains why she avoids using AI to write her content, preferring the neurological benefits of the manual writing process to refine her thinking. Lucy McCarraher acknowledges that for those with dyslexia or language barriers, BookMagic AI offers voice-to-text functions. This allows authors to speak their ideas while still benefiting from the logical structure of a written format.

Determining the Right Time to Write a Business Book

Lucy McCarraher suggests that the ideal time to write a book is after at least two years of business operation with proven client outcomes. However, she notes that some entrepreneurs use a book as a "jumping off point" for a new venture. Both speakers agree that waiting for perfect alignment or inspiration is a mistake, as the act of writing itself generates inspiration.
